Construction
It’s a bodysuit over a pair of shorts, with a vinyl cropped jacket. I wear the shorts, tights, and jacket regularly. Just not together. The jacket is based off of a child’s pullover. The bodysuit is a Vogue dress pattern that I heavily altered. The leggings I made a cutout pattern for. They were a fun spandex experiment. The trim on the boots and jacket are leftovers from foam floor mats that matched the look of the zippers.
